Becoming Irate: Frustration Leading to Anger

When individuals become irate, it often stems from a lack of understanding or cooperation, escalating as the conversation continues. An example provided is when a hotel loses a reservation despite having proof, causing frustration to build. The speaker stresses the value of addressing anger in a constructive manner to avoid escalating conflicts.
